SM 2.494 (now) QC3.0Ghz 12gb Win7 Pro
was about to print something and somehow my mouse went into scroll mode and kept
changing the printer ( use fax for printing, and a label printer)
so .. I was able to quit and restart the print process
I entered print preview ( with the normal 8-1/2" x11 printer) and all I saw was several
"pages"
that were 1" x 6"... as if they were all print labels, even though the default printer
8-12x11 was selected
I rechecked the page setup, and eventually removed the regular printer, the
label printer
and reinstalled the software again.... no change
couldnt find an answer anywhere about how to change the erroneous print preview
FF worked OK with print preview
there were some old info (2015) about the config file, I changed some features
as well as eventually resetting all the printer settings... nothing resolved
the problem
I eventually restore a previous settings version using Mozback, and all was
well
can the config file get screwed up,and potentially be the real culprit in this now
resolved matter
anyone have a similar problem, and resolve it any other way
The same thing happens to me occasionally -- here's my solution:
Enter "about:config"
Search for "print"
Look in the "value" column for any printers that are inexplicably set for the wrong width
and height (in your case, 1" x 6")
Double-click those rows and set the correct width and height
